A certain corned beef sandwich told me that this is because of a bug involving arithmetic on arrays that wasn't fixed until '18.

Thanks to sluicebox for the fix. I've updated the expresions based on his fix.

Quote
You can work around at least some of these compiler bugs in the older version, this particular problem is with the "+=" expressions. (Or -=, *=, /=, etc).

You can avoid this problem by expanding all of those lines like this:

(+= [ax t] 4)

becomes:

(= [ax t] (+ [ax t] 4))
